Experiment 1
  To introduce the fundamentals of welding, study different types of weld joints,
             and perform electric arc welding to weld various joints.
 Apparatus:
 Electric Arc Welding Plant
 Figure:
 Theory:
 Welding is a process of joining two or more metal pieces by applying heat or pressure, with
 or without filler material. It is widely used in industries such as construction, automotive,
 aerospace, and manufacturing. Welding processes can be classified into different categories,
 including fusion welding (arc welding, gas welding) and solid-state welding (friction
 welding, ultrasonic welding).
 Types of Weld Joints:
    1. Butt Joint: Two metal pieces are placed in the same plane and welded along the
       joining edge.
    2. Lap Joint: One piece overlaps the other, and welding is done along the overlapping
       edge.
    3. Tee Joint: One metal piece is positioned perpendicular to another, forming a ‘T’
       shape, and welding is done along the intersection.
    4. Corner Joint: Two pieces are joined at a right angle, forming an ‘L’ shape.
    5. Edge Joint: The edges of two metal pieces are placed together and welded along the
       length.

 Procedure:
 1. Preparation of Workpieces:
        o Clean the metal surfaces using a wire brush or grinder to remove rust, oil, or dirt.
        o Align the workpieces as per the selected weld joint type and secure them using
           clamps.
 2. Setting Up the Welding Machine:
        o Connect the electrode holder and ground cable properly.
        o Select the correct current setting based on the electrode and material thickness.
 3. Striking the Arc:
        o Hold the electrode at a slight angle and strike it against the metal surface like
           striking a match.
        o Once the arc is established, maintain a consistent gap between the electrode and
           workpiece.
 4. Welding Process:
        o Move the electrode steadily along the joint, maintaining a uniform bead.
        o Adjust travel speed and electrode angle to avoid defects like porosity and
           undercut.
 5. Cooling and Cleaning:
        o Allow the welded joint to cool naturally.
        o Remove slag using a chipping hammer and clean with a wire brush.
 6. Inspection of Weld:
        o Check for uniformity, penetration, and any visible defects.
        o Perform necessary corrections if required.
 Precautions:
       Always wear proper PPE to protect from heat, sparks, and UV radiation.
       Ensure proper ventilation to prevent fume inhalation.
       Do not touch hot metal surfaces immediately after welding.
       Check electrical connections before starting the welding process.
       Keep flammable materials away from the welding area.
